101. Deputy Catherine Connolly asked the Minister for Health the status of plans for a new model 4 hospital in Galway;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[7237/23]

I thank the Deputy for her question, as the Deputy will be aware I fully support developments at Galway University Hospital, which comprises both University Hospital Galway and Merlin Park University Hospital.

One such project is the Emergency Department and Women & Children’s block which will address the issues with current accommodation at the hospital, a huge development with 7 floors which will provide modern, fit-for-purpose facilities for patients and staff. Enabling works are expected to commence during 2023.

A proposal for a new Cancer Care Centre at GUH has now been submitted to the HSE, and funding for progressing the evaluation is allocated in this year’s Capital Plan. This facility will provide up-to-date facilities for cancer services at GUH, which is the designated cancer centre for the Saolta region.

A new elective hospital at the Merlin Park site was approved by Government in December last year which will treat over 175,000 patients annually. A new six-floor medical laboratory development at UHG is at appraisal stage, and this will provide integrated access to lab facilities across hospital and community services. My own view is that additional bed capacity is also needed at GUH, and I understand that a proposal is being drafted by the hospital currently for a 72 bed development.
